We arrive with submersible pumps and truck-mount extractors that get standing water out of a Jamestown property before it soaks deeper into the subfloor. Every extraction job includes moisture mapping so we know exactly which materials are still holding water once the visible flooding is gone.
Once water is out, we bring in commercial air movers and LGR dehumidifiers, positioned using psychrometric readings rather than guesswork, with daily drying logs so you can see the numbers improving, not just take our word for it.
For families in Jamestown, this covers flood-cut drywall removal, subfloor evaluation, and packing out salvageable belongings for cleaning, with clear photo documentation at every stage for your insurance claim.
Multi-unit and commercial Jamestown properties get their own project manager plus enough drying equipment to cover the real square footage, not a token setup — we know a flooded lobby or a leaking unit above tenants below has to move fast.
When a Jamestown job involves sewage backup, our team suits up in full PPE, applies EPA-registered antimicrobials, and safely disposes of porous materials that can't be saved.

Turn off the water supply if you can reach it safely, keep people and pets out of the flooded area, and don't run electrical devices near standing water.

Drying time varies with material and how quickly extraction started, but 3 to 5 days is typical for most Jamestown jobs.
Quick extraction and drying in Jamestown significantly lowers mold risk, since spores need sustained moisture over roughly a day or two to establish.
